Appearing for the first time since fracturing his fibula near his left ankle on June 27, Andy Pettitte pitched five shutout innings to lead the Bombers to a 4-2 victory over the Toronto Blue Jays yesterday afternoon at Yankee Stadium in the Bronx.     &#34;My arm feels great. My break area feels great. I&#39;m a hundred percent,” said Pettitte, 40, a member of the “Core Four” who was the winningest hurler in the 2000s. &#34;Just real happy with how my arm is feeling.
